Ayesha Curry is a woman of many talents. She is a world-famous chef, who has written best-selling cookbooks such as “The Full Plate” and “The Seasoned Life.” Apart from this, Ayesha has also dipped her toes into reality television. She has worked on shows like “About Last Night,” “Family Food Fight,” and “Ayesha’s Home Kitchen.” But the lesser-known fact about her is Ayesha’s foray into the spotlight was with acting as she played a small-part role in the 2008 movie, “Love for Sale”.
Now, her popularity and acting chops have earned Ayesha her very first major motion picture movie role, as she stars alongside Lindsay Lohan in “Irish Wish”, which releases on Netflix on 15th March. In a recent social media exchange, Ayesha showed some love to her Irish Wish co-star. Lohan posted a picture on Instagram with her financier beau, Bader Shammas. Ayesha commented on the picture by writing, “My Babiesss.”

Lohan and Ayesha share a wonderful equation with each other, and the “Mean Girls” actress even named Ayesha and Steph as the godparents to her 7-month-old son, Luai. Recently, Lindsay Lohan made a very rare public appearance in Atlanta, where she watched Stephen Curry take on the Atlanta Hawks. But before the game, Steph gave Luai a very special gift.
“Godfather” Stephen Curry gifts Luai an autographed Warriors jersey
On 3rd February, Lindsay Lohan and Bader Shammas watched the Golden State Warriors take on the Atlanta Hawks at the State Farm Arena in Atlanta. While the Warriors lost the game, Steph made the day of Lohan and her son Luai. Curry approached Lohan and Shammas, who were sitting courtside, and gifted them a signed Warriors’ jersey which read, “To Luai” and “Your godparents love you!” Warriors!!”

Later, Curry’s representative confirmed to Today.com that Stephen and Ayesha are indeed godparents to Luai, who was born in July 2023. Married since 2022, Lohan and Shammas live a quiet life away from the spotlight in Dubai.

Despite making Lohan’s day, Steph Curry had a bittersweet night himself. Curry sank 10 three-pointers in a 60-point performance. But despite Steph’s heroics, the Warriors lost the game in overtime by a scoreline of 141-134. While she may have seen the Warriors win, it seems like Lindsay Lohan enjoyed the night as she took to her Instagram story to post that she loves basketball and enjoyed the date night.
